Haze Seas Devil Fruits
Devil Fruits are one of the main build paths in Haze Seas. Fruit choices shape grinding speed, PvP pressure, mobility, and boss farming. Use this hard data to plan spawns, stock, and awakenings.
Fruit Spawn Timer
60 minutesA fruit spawns on the map every 60 minutes. Check the map or stock channel around the hourly timer instead of searching randomly.
Fruit Despawn Timer
20 minutesA spawned fruit despawns after 20 minutes. Move quickly after a fruit appears, especially on public servers where other players are also hunting.
VIP Server Fruit Limit
5-fruit limitFruits can spawn in VIP servers with a listed limit of 5. Use VIP servers for cleaner fruit hunting routes and fewer interruptions.
Fruit Stock Tracking
Discord #fruit-stockThe official Discord includes a fruit-stock channel for live Devil Fruit stock tracking. Check stock before spending cash, gems, or rerolls.
Fruit Data Cards
Trello Devil FruitsThe official Trello separates Devil Fruits into their own reference area alongside Swords, Fighting Styles, Races, NPCs, and Bosses. Open the fruit card before replacing your current fruit.
Known Fruit Roster
33 fruitsClear, Chop, Spin, Spike, Bomb, Barrier, Paw, Smoke, Sand, String, Mammoth, Buddha, Snow, Tremor, Gas, Gravity, Flame, Shadow, Light, Operation, Ice, Electricity, Magma, Love, Gum, Darkness, Magnet, Phoenix, Soul, Leopard, Venom, Dragon, and Dough.

Haze Seas Races
Races in Haze Seas affect movement, health, stamina, regeneration, Haki access, and long-term build direction. Use early race spins carefully when deciding whether to keep a rare, legendary, or mythical race for grinding, PvP, or sea progression.
D. Clan
Mythical0.1% roll · X-shaped scar. Grants health regen, walk speed, SkyWalk, Observation Haki, stamina, health, and Conquerors Spirit. Best for endgame PvP and mobility. Keep.
Dragonoid
Legendary1% roll · Dragon wings and tail. Health regen, Observation Haki, health, and jump power. Best for durable builds and late-game progression. Keep.
Lunarian
Legendary1% roll · Black wings and fire orb. SkyWalk, health regen, jump power, and stamina. Best for mobility, sustain, and vertical movement. Keep.
Demon
Rare8.9% roll · Demon horns and black tail. Walk speed, health, and stamina. Best for aggressive PvP movement and fast questing. Keep unless chasing legendary or mythical.
Celestial Dragon
Rare8.9% roll · Glass helmet. Quest money, health, and stamina. Best for money farming and balanced progression. Keep for farming.
Mink
Uncommon35% roll · Rabbit ears. Walk speed, jump power, and stamina. Best for movement and mobility-focused grinding. Keep early, reroll later.
Fishman
Uncommon35% roll · Shark fin. Health and swim speed. Best for sea movement and island-to-island travel. Keep early if travel speed matters.
Cyborg
Uncommon35% roll · Science tank. Health and health regeneration. Best for safer early combat and durability. Keep early, reroll later.
Skypeian
Uncommon35% roll · Angel wings. Stamina and jump power. Best for jumping, stamina, and early movement. Keep early, reroll later.
Human
Common55% roll · No visible trait. Default starter race with no build-defining bonus. Reroll when spins are available.
3 Eyed Tribe
Common55% roll · Third eye. Minor stamina bonus for early support. Reroll when spins are available.
Elf
Common55% roll · Elf ears. Minor health regeneration bonus for early support. Reroll when spins are available.
Haze Seas Weapons and Fighting Styles
Weapons and fighting styles define how a Haze Seas build plays when fruit abilities are on cooldown or when you want a sword-focused route. Use this comparison to decide what to buy early, farm from bosses, and target for late-game PvP or sea events.
Yoru / Dark Blade
Mythical SwordShop, gifting, or trading route (1,200 Robux). Premium PvP sword builds for serious sword investment.
Enma
Legendary SwordDefeat Enma Boss (10% drop). Major late-game sword damage target.
3 Sword Style
Legendary SwordDefeat 3SS Boss (5% drop). Combo-focused multi-sword pressure.
Sea Beast Hammer V2
Legendary WeaponDefeat White Sea Beast (3.5% drop). Sea-event weapon builds.
Golden Staff
Legendary SwordDefeat Thunder God on Sky Islands (1% drop). Electricity-linked sword builds.
Raiu
Legendary SwordShiryu Scroll route at Skull Island. Fast sword pressure for late progression.
Shusui
Legendary SwordDefeat Ryummy at Thriller Boat (boss drop). Late-game sword progression.
Fishman Trident
Legendary SwordFishman Island weapon route. Water-themed sword builds while progressing the island.
Bisento
Legendary SwordPurchase from Bella NPC (500,000 Money). Reliable purchased sword before harder drops.
Bisento V2
Rare SwordDefeat Tremor Girl (20% drop). Upgraded Bisento for super boss farming.
Operation Blade
Legendary SwordMagma Minion route (250,000 Money). Ability-themed sword builds.
Sea Beast Hammer
Legendary WeaponDefeat Sea Beast at Rocky Pillars (50% drop). Heavy damage and sea-event farming.
Mace
Rare WeaponDefeat Mace Boss on Winter Island (100% drop). Guaranteed heavy melee route.
Mace V2
Legendary WeaponDefeat Mace V2 Boss (1% drop). Upgraded heavy weapon pressure.
2 Sword Style
Rare Sword StylePurchase from Mr White (100,000 Money). Early sword combos.
2 Sword Style V2
Rare Sword StyleDefeat Dual Swordsman at Logue City (10% drop). Mid-game sword combos.
Shark Blade
Rare SwordDefeat Shark Boss at Shark Park (5% drop). Early boss-drop sword.
Katana
Common SwordSword shop purchase. Starter sword before rare and legendary routes open.
Combat
Starter StyleDefault fighting style. First levels and basic melee.
Black Leg
Fighting StyleTrainer at Sea Restaurant (Money purchase). Practical first melee upgrade.
Electro
Fighting StyleTrainer at Udon Prison (Money purchase). Fast melee and stun pressure.
Fish-Man Karate
Fighting StyleTrainer on Fishman progression route. Balanced PvE and PvP melee.
Cyborg
Fighting StyleAdvanced trainer route. Burst-focused ability-based melee builds.
Dragonic / Dragon Claw
Fighting StyleAdvanced trainer route. Late-game aggressive melee pressure.
Haze Seas Bosses Islands and Sea Events
Haze Seas progression is built around island routes, boss farming, item drops, super bosses, and sea events. Use this map and drop guide to decide what to farm next as you push from the First Sea into late-game routes.
Shark Park — Shark Boss (Lv 120)
Drops Shark Blade. Farm for an early rare sword before pushing deeper into First Sea progression.
Desert Ruins — Bomb Boss (Lv 200)
Boss progression route used mainly for leveling toward higher-level island content.
Sea Restaurant — Krieg Boss (Lv 300)
Drops Gold Pauldrons. Early accessory farming and Black Leg progression.
Logue Town — Tashii (Lv 400)
Drops Glasses. Continue farming before moving into mid-game boss routes.
Tall Woods — King Gorilla (Lv 550)
Drops Monkey Crown. Checkpoint for players building accessory collections.
Marine Base Town — Marine Captain (Lv 650)
Drops Iron Jaw and Lava Ore. Farm for boss progression and upgrade materials.
Three Islands — Minotaur (Lv 750)
Drops Oversized Helmet. Mid-game stop before Marine HQ and Sky Islands.
Marine HQ — Ice Admiral (Lv 900)
Drops Sleeping Mask and TremorBeard Key. Prepares for special boss routes.
Sky Islands — Thunder God (Lv 1100)
Drops Golden Staff and Thunder Drums. Farm for the Golden Staff and electricity-themed routes.
Revolutionary Base — Revolutionary Boss (Lv 1250)
Boss progression route before pushing into prison and late First Sea zones.
Impel Jail — Warden (Lv 1400)
Drops Warden Hat and Match. Key stop before Hot Island and Fishman Island.
Hot Island — Vergo (Lv 1500)
Drops Black Shades. Accessory farming and late First Sea progression.
Cold Island Lab — Harpy (Lv 1550)
Drops Ice Ore. Tied to Sea Beast Core and Blacksmith crafting progression.
Fishman Island — Neptune (Lv 1700)
Drops Neptune Crown and Fork. Farm for Fishman-related equipment routes.
Skull Island — Shiryu (Lv 1850)
Drops Scroll for Raiu progression. Key stop for late First Sea weapon routes.
Bubble Island — G4 Boss (Lv 2000)
Drops Gear 4 Book. Important for Gear 4-related progression.
Thriller Boat — Ryummy (Lv 2150)
Drops Shusui and Blue Scarf. Major late First Sea sword-farming target.
Logue City — Dual Swordsman (Lv 500)
Drops 2 Sword Style V2, Green Bandana, and Book. Farm after planning 2 Sword Style progression.
Winter Island — Mace Boss (Lv 700)
Drops Mace. Guaranteed heavy weapon route before rarer upgrades.
Rocky Pillars — Sea Beast (Lv 700)
Drops Sea Beast Hammer, Sea Beast Core, Money, Gems, and Bounty. Heavy weapon and material farming.
Sea Route — White Sea Beast
Drops Sea Beast Hammer V2. Farm for the upgraded Sea Beast Hammer path.
